Is Martha Stewart a Trained Chef? The Truth Behind Her Culinary Skills

Martha Stewart is widely recognized as a lifestyle authority and business leader, but many people ask whether she is a trained chef. Her name often appears alongside premium cooking tools, magazine covers, and bestselling cookbooks, creating curiosity about her professional background.

Martha Stewart Approach To Cooking Methods

Instead of operating as a restaurant chef, Martha Stewart developed a precise, repeatable style that suits media and home cooks. She focuses on clear steps, reliable timing, and visual appeal, which aligns with television and publishing rather than brigade-style kitchens.

Her techniques often highlight classic methods such as proper knife handling, temperature control, and ingredient quality. By breaking down complex procedures into manageable actions, she makes advanced skills approachable for beginners and experienced cooks alike.

Media Influence And Public Persona

Through magazines, television shows, and social platforms, Martha Stewart has shaped how audiences view home cooking and entertaining. Her brand merges cooking with design, entertaining etiquette, and seasonal living, presenting food as part of a refined lifestyle.

This broad influence sometimes blurs the line between chef and lifestyle expert. While she may not hold formal chef credentials, her impact on culinary culture and home cooking education is substantial and well documented.

Industry Recognition And Legacy

Throughout her career, Martha Stewart has received honors that acknowledge her cultural influence and contributions to hospitality and media. Awards such as the James Beard Foundation Lifetime Achievement highlight her impact beyond traditional culinary tracks.

Her legacy combines instruction, branding, and consistency, offering a model for how food personalities can build long-term relevance. While distinct from restaurant-based chefs, her work has elevated standards for home cooking and entertaining.
